我编辑VideoViewDemo是因为我需要在相同布局中使用两个(或多个)流rtsp。

我使用带有两个VideoView的相对布局,并在VideoViewDemo中添加代码以填充每个表面。

结果是两个视频相互重叠,logcat多次给我这个错误:

E/SurfaceTextureClient(4717): Surface::lock failed, already locked
01-15 17:41:07.328: E/VitamioPlayer: LOCK BUFFER FAILED
E/SurfaceTexture(144): [SurfaceView] dequeueBuffer: can’t dequeue multiple buffers without setting the buffer count


我用MediaPlayer演示制作了同样的东西,效果相同...

我读到这是库错误,有人解决了吗?

最佳答案

Vitamio不支持多个videoView。也许将来会增加。

09-30 18:22
查看更多